  • Abstract
    This paper reports on the demonstration of ablation processing of hydroxyapatite (HAp) and collagen using a high intensity femtosecond laser with pulsewidth controllable from 50 fs to 2.5 ps operating at 1 kpps. This work focuses on the chemical properties of ablated surface of HAp and collagen as a function of pulsewidth.
